By now pretty much all of the 8 billion people on Planet Earth have seen the Coldplay concert meme. But in all of the parodies and reenactments, Sue Bird and Megan Rapinoe may have done it best.
In case you need your memory jogged, Astronomer CEO Andy Byron was caught on camera at a Coldplay concert with his arms wrapped around the company’s “Chief People Officer” Kristin Cabot. As soon as they were shown on the screen at Gilette Stadium, they quickly tried to distance themselves from each other, but it was too late as their affair would soon become meme fodder for the entire universe.
The Coldplay concert meme has then been reenacted thousands of times in the weeks since, including by SportsCenter anchors Randy Scott and Gary Striewski. But nobody has done it better than women’s sports power couple Sue Bird and Megan Rapinoe at Tuesday’s Seattle Storm game.
The former United States Women’s National Team star and Seattle Storm legend often attend games together. However, when Rapinoe was shown on the scoreboard, Bird was not in the empty seat next to her. With Coldplay playing in the background, you probably figured what was coming next.
Sue Bird was in the upper reaches of Climate Pledge Arena with the arms of Seattle Storm mascot Doppler wrapped around her.
